Roofing in Spring Branch, and why it isn't like anywhere else

Spring Branch is unincorporated Comal County, strung along US-281 between San Antonio and Blanco, west of Canyon Lake and north of the Guadalupe River. There is no city building department here. Permitting and inspection follow Comal County requirements rather than a municipal code, and because the boundaries in this stretch are not intuitive, we confirm the applicable authority for your specific address before we schedule anything rather than assuming it.

The housing stock is mostly custom: 1990s through 2020s builds on acreage with complex, cut-up rooflines, older ranch homes scattered between them, and a meaningful number of metal outbuildings, barns, and workshops that need to be scoped separately from the house. The ground is limestone and thin caliche, so the expansive-clay failures that dominate the eastern metro are largely absent. What matters here instead is ultraviolet exposure, wind on exposed ridge positions, hail, wildfire in the Ashe juniper, and — for a large share of properties — whether the roof feeds a cistern.

Rainwater catchment as a design constraint
Well water is common and rainwater collection is genuinely widespread here, not a novelty. On a collecting roof the material, the coating, the flashing metals, and the sealants all become water-quality decisions.
Wildfire in the Ashe juniper
Heavy cedar and live oak carry fire readily and terrain moves it uphill fast. Ember intrusion at vents, soffits, and valleys is the realistic failure mode, not direct flame on the field of the roof.
Sustained wind on exposed ridges
Hilltop and ridge-position homes have no upwind obstruction. Ridge caps, rake edges, and metal panel terminations move first under frontal wind and thunderstorm outflow.
Hail
The 281 corridor takes recurring hail. Impact rating governs on asphalt and panel gauge governs on metal, and the two produce very different claim conversations.
Ultraviolet exposure
Thin canopy on ridge and pasture lots means unshaded south and west slopes. Asphalt oxidizes unevenly and one side of a roof commonly reaches end of life years before the other.
Limestone and thin caliche
Very little seasonal soil movement. Chimney and wall-to-roof flashing failures here are almost always workmanship or age rather than foundation-driven separation.

Asphalt shingle on a collecting roof
The most consequential problem we find in Spring Branch is a home collecting potable water off an asphalt roof. Granules and hydrocarbons shed into the cistern continuously, and no amount of filtration downstream makes that a good design.
Zinc and copper algae strips above a cistern
Ridge-mounted zinc or copper strips work by dissolving metal into the runoff. On a catchment roof that is a contaminant path straight into the tank, and we see them installed by contractors who never asked about the cistern.
Undersized gutters and no first-flush provision
Catchment volume and cedar and oak leaf load both argue for larger troughs. Homes without a first-flush diverter send the dirtiest inch of every rain event directly into storage.
Exposed-fastener metal backing out
Older barn-style and ranch metal roofs loosen their screws with thermal cycling. Gaskets harden, fastener holes elongate, and each becomes a leak path — on the house and on the outbuildings alike.
Combustible eave, soffit, and valley detail
Open soffits, unscreened vents, and woven shingle valleys packed with cedar debris are the actual ignition points on cedar-adjacent acreage.
Wind-lifted ridge and rake detail on ridge lots
Exposed positions lose caps and rake edges at the corners first. Once water gets under the field from the top, the failure propagates downward across the slope.

We ask one question in Spring Branch before we specify anything: does this home collect rainwater? A surprising number of contractors never ask, and the answer changes the entire material conversation — not the shingle color, the whole assembly. If the roof feeds a cistern that supplies the house, then the roof is part of a potable water system, and it has to be engineered as one.

Roofing material determines water quality

Metal is the accepted catchment surface, and specifically Galvalume or painted steel with a coating rated food-safe for potable collection. The surface is inert, it sheds cleanly, it does not shed particulate into the tank, and it does not hold organic debris the way a granular surface does. Asphalt shingle is not suitable for potable collection. It sheds granules for its entire service life and leaches hydrocarbons from the asphalt binder, particularly when it is hot — which in Comal County is most of the year. We will install asphalt on a Spring Branch home, but not on one collecting drinking water, and we will say so plainly rather than quietly taking the job.

Everything installed on a catchment roof is a water-quality decision

The panel is only the start. Zinc and copper algae strips function by dissolving metal into the runoff, so on a catchment roof they are a contaminant source and we do not use them. Lead-based flashing is disqualifying outright. Sealants have to be selected for potable contact rather than picked off the truck. Fasteners and trim metals need to be compatible with the panel so galvanic corrosion does not put dissolved metal into the tank. These are small line items individually and collectively they determine whether the system is safe.

Gutters and first-flush are part of the roofing scope here

On a catchment property the gutter is conveyance infrastructure, not trim. It gets sized for both cedar and oak leaf load and for the collection volume the owner actually wants, with downspout placement coordinated to the tank rather than to the shortest run. First-flush diversion — dumping the first volume of each event, which carries the accumulated dust, pollen, and droppings — belongs in the roofing scope because it is plumbed into the downspouts we install. Gutter guard selection matters too, since a screen that traps organic material above the trough turns into a compost layer feeding the tank.

Wildfire detail matters more than shingle brand

On cedar-adjacent acreage the assembly's fire class is only part of the answer. Embers enter through unscreened vents, lodge in open soffits, and ignite debris packed into valleys and gutters. We specify Class A assemblies, corrosion-resistant metal mesh on every vent opening, non-combustible edge and eave detail, and open metal valleys rather than woven shingle valleys. That package does more for a Spring Branch home than moving up a shingle tier.

Access is a real cost, and we itemize it

Long private driveways on acreage are not a minor inconvenience. Material delivery may need a smaller truck or a second staging move, dumpster placement has to be planned rather than assumed, and crew access is slower on every trip. We would rather show you that as a line item than bury it in a square-foot price that looks arbitrary.

What roofing actually costs in Spring Branch

Spring Branch prices above the metro baseline for four structural reasons: drive distance, acreage access, steep and complex Hill Country rooflines, and a high share of metal work. Ranges are 2026 figures for typical single-family homes. These are ranges based on typical local jobs, and the actual number depends on your roof.

Small repair
$600 – $1,500
Pipe boot, ridge cap section, exposed-fastener screw and gasket replacement, minor flashing patch. Access on long driveways affects the low end.
Mid repair
$1,500 – $4,400
Chimney reflash, valley re-detail, metal panel section replacement, wildfire vent screening and eave detailing.
Architectural asphalt reroof (2,400 sq ft roof footprint)
$13,800 – $17,400
Full tearoff, synthetic underlayment, new flashings, balanced ventilation. Not specified on homes collecting potable water.
Class 4 impact reroof
$16,000 – $20,300
The right asphalt answer in the 281 hail corridor, with UL 2218 certification for your carrier discount.
Standing seam metal
$23,200 – $37,800
24-gauge Galvalume or painted steel with concealed clips. Catchment-appropriate coatings specified where the roof feeds a cistern. Frequently the correct answer here, not a premium add-on.
6-inch seamless gutters (full house)
$2,400 – $5,200
Aluminum with 3x4 downspouts, engineered downslope discharge, and tank routing plus first-flush provision on catchment properties. Repairs typically $350 – $1,000.

Spring Branch replacements are commonly financed over 60–144 months, and the longer terms matter here because standing seam metal carries a higher first cost against a much longer service life — and because on a catchment property metal is frequently not optional in the way it is elsewhere. We show the monthly figure on both the asphalt and metal paths side by side so the comparison is cost of ownership rather than sticker price.

Wind and hail deductibles in Comal County commonly run 1–2% of dwelling coverage, and some carriers apply higher percentages along the 281 hail corridor. On a $550,000 dwelling limit that means $5,500–$11,000 out of pocket on an approved claim, which is usually the figure that actually needs financing.

24-gauge standing seam metal with catchment-appropriate coating
Galvalume or painted steel with a food-safe coating is the accepted potable-collection surface. Concealed clips mean no exposed fasteners to back out, better performance under sustained ridge wind, and a service life that suits long-term acreage owners.
Class A wildfire-resistant assembly with ember-resistant vent screening
Corrosion-resistant metal mesh on every vent opening, non-combustible eave and edge detail, and open metal valleys. Ember intrusion, not flame contact, is the realistic failure mode in the Ashe juniper.
High-temperature synthetic underlayment
Under metal and on high-UV exposed slopes, standard underlayment degrades early. High-temp product is baseline on Spring Branch metal installations.
Class 4 impact-rated asphalt (Malarkey Legacy, GAF Armorshield II)
When metal is not the budget answer and the roof is not collecting potable water, this is the correct asphalt specification for 281-corridor hail, with a carrier discount attached.
6-inch seamless gutters sized for leaf load and catchment volume
Handles cedar and live oak debris, carries collection volume to the tank, and routes overflow downslope away from the structure. First-flush diversion is plumbed into the downspouts as part of the scope.
Separate metal scope for barns, workshops, and outbuildings
Purlin-mounted agricultural metal is a different assembly from a residential standing seam roof and deserves its own specification, gauge, and price rather than being folded into the house number.

Rainwater catchment roofing is a service line here in a way it is nowhere else in our area. If your home collects the water it drinks, the roof is part of a potable water system and we engineer it as one: Galvalume or painted steel with a coating documented as food-safe for potable contact, no zinc or copper algae strips, no lead-based flashing, sealants selected for potable contact, and trim and fastener metals chosen for galvanic compatibility so nothing dissolves into your tank. We size the gutters for both cedar and live oak leaf load and for the collection volume you actually want, place downspouts to serve the tank rather than the shortest run, and plumb first-flush diversion into the system as part of the roofing scope. We ask whether you collect before we specify anything, because the answer changes the entire material conversation.

Standing seam metal roofing is a larger share of our Spring Branch work than of our metro work, and we treat it as a primary service rather than an upgrade path. We install 24-gauge Galvalume or painted steel with concealed clips over high-temperature underlayment and a solid deck, with fabricated valley, hip, and ridge detail rather than off-the-shelf trim. On ridge-exposed and cedar-adjacent lots, and for owners who intend to stay on the property long term, this is frequently the recommendation that produces the lowest cost per year of service.

Roof replacement in asphalt remains the right answer for many Spring Branch budgets on homes that are not collecting potable water, and when it is, we specify Class 4 impact-rated systems given 281-corridor hail — full tearoff, high-temperature synthetic underlayment on high-UV exposures, ice-and-water membrane in valleys and at wall lines, all new flashings, balanced ventilation, and a manufacturer system warranty registered in the homeowner's name.

Roof repair in Spring Branch looks different from repair in the metro because the soil does not move much. Our repair calls here are dominated by wind-lifted ridge and rake detail on exposed positions, exposed-fastener metal screws that have backed out with thermal cycling, limb impact under live oak, and aging flashing that has simply reached the end of its service life. Read the hail damage guide for how we distinguish functional from cosmetic storm damage before recommending anything.

Wildfire hardening is a distinct service line on cedar-break acreage throughout the FM 311 and FM 3351 corridors. We screen every vent opening with corrosion-resistant metal mesh, replace combustible eave and edge detail with non-combustible material, convert woven shingle valleys to open metal valleys, and clear the debris accumulation points where embers actually take hold.

Gutter installation and gutter repair carries two extra dimensions here: the ground slopes, and the water may be going into a tank. We install 6-inch seamless aluminum with correctly spaced 3x4 downspouts, engineer the discharge so overflow runs down and away from the structure rather than channeling back toward it on a grade, and on catchment properties coordinate routing and first-flush provision with the storage system. Our seamless gutter installation and repair guide covers sizing, downspout spacing, and discharge in detail.

Barn, workshop, and outbuilding metal is scoped and priced as its own line rather than folded into the house. Purlin-mounted agricultural metal is a different assembly with different gauge, fastening, and underlayment questions, and on many Spring Branch properties the outbuilding roof is in worse condition than the house.

How Hill Country conditions actually damage Spring Branch roofs

Take expansive clay out of the equation and four loads remain: ultraviolet, wind, hail, and fire — plus one constraint no other city on this site shares.

Catchment as a constraint, not a load. This is the one that separates Spring Branch. A roof feeding a cistern has to be evaluated for what it puts into the water as well as for what it keeps out of the house. Granule shed, hydrocarbon leaching, dissolved zinc and copper, lead in older flashing, and sealant chemistry are all water-quality questions, and none of them show up on a standard roof inspection form. We inspect for them because on these properties they matter more than shingle brand.

Wildfire in the Ashe juniper. Cedar carries fire readily and the terrain moves it uphill fast. In almost every case the structure is lost to embers entering unscreened vents, lodging in open soffits, or igniting debris packed in valleys and gutters — not to a flame front touching the roof surface. That is why our wildfire work concentrates on openings and edges rather than on the field of the roof.

Wind on exposed ridge positions. Hilltop homes have no upwind obstruction, so thunderstorm outflow and frontal wind arrive at full speed. Ridge caps and rake edges lift at the corners first. On metal, the failure point is panel termination and clip spacing rather than the field of the panel. Hand-sealed caps, starter strip at every rake and eave, and correct fastener patterns are baseline here.

Hail along the 281 corridor. Recurring 1"–2" events with larger stones on record. On asphalt, Class 4 impact rating is the correct specification and carries a carrier discount. On metal, panel gauge governs — thinner panels dent visibly without losing function, which is a claim conversation we help homeowners navigate honestly rather than filing on cosmetic denting.

Ultraviolet on unshaded slopes. Pasture and ridge lots carry thin canopy, so south and west slopes take an unshaded load all day. The practical result is that one side of a roof reaches end of life several years before the other. We evaluate slopes independently rather than assigning a single age to the whole roof.

Live oak canopy and limb impact. Where the oaks are heavy, expect seasonal leaf load in the gutters, moisture retention on shaded slopes, and genuine limb-impact risk. A live oak limb in a wind event will go through decking, and that is a structural repair rather than a shingle repair — and on a catchment property it is also a contamination event worth flushing the system over.
